Manatee that made rare trip to New England waters found dead weeks later

Por: WGN-TV Nation October 07, 2023

thumbnail

() – A manatee in Rhode Island waters has been found dead offshore, according to Connecticut’s Mystic Aquarium. “We are so saddened by it,” Sara Callan, manager of Mystic’s animal rescue program, told Nexstar’s WPRI. Manatees are rarely seen as far north as New England.
